Rovo Search offers multiple improvements to your previous search experience:
Rich modernized user experience
Smart answers in search to important questions covering People, Topics, Bookmarks and QnA (available if AI is enabled)
Personalized results based on interaction signals
Rovo Chrome Extension allowing you to easily search Atlassian products from your browser
Improving discoverability by surfacing more teaching moments in Quick Find
Rovo Search offers multiple ways to access your company's knowledge. It allows you to search across your Atlassian products and your Third party products (3P) directly from Confluence with various ways to filter and sort your search results. This feature will start rolling out to Premium and Enterprise plans next week, with Standard coming later in the year.

With Quick find, locating your recent work and picking up where you left off has become easier! Your recent search queries and recently viewed content will be displayed before you start typing, and as you begin to type in the search bar within Confluence, you’ll see:
content you recently viewed or edited in your Atlassian products and selected 3P products
your search results
related spaces based on your query
related people based on your query
With Full page search, you will have the option to see results from your other Atlassian products, such as Jira and Loom - using the filters on the right, in addition to your default results from Confluence. Once your admin has connected 3Ps you will also be able to search content from them - a full list of available Atlassian and 3P connectors (over 50 of them!) is listed here: https://www.atlassian.com/software/rovo/connectors
You can also connect your Confluence Data Centre to Rovo Search and let users search across your Confluence Data Centre content from your Confluence Cloud site!
Sorting
We’ve heard from many of you who want to locate and update outdated content, so we’ve introduced a feature to sort your Confluence results by relevance, content creation date, and last update date.
Filter by verified
You will be able to narrow down your Confluence search results to only show pages that your team has verified.
Filter by owner
We’re excited to roll out a highly requested feature that allows you to filter Confluence results by the owner of the content. When combined with sorting options, you’ll be able to find all the pages you created when you first joined the company.
Filter by status
We know this was a highly requested ask with over 350 votes on JAC. We’ve added support so you can now search for the standard pages statuses.
To access these new filters choose the Confluence app on the right hand side of your search results page in Confluence.
As well as being able to search across all your products from Confluence, you can also do the same in Atlassian home and Focus! We are planning on bringing Rovo Search to Jira next, with other Atlassian products planned for later in the year.
